Luxury Compact SUVs: Urban Sophistication Meets Dynamic Versatility
The luxury compact SUV segment remains a hotbed of competition, attracting a broad spectrum of buyers seeking a blend of practicality, style, and premium features without the bulk of larger vehicles. In 2025, both BMW and Mercedes-Benz offer compelling choices, often serving as an entry point into their respective luxury ecosystems.
BMW’s X3 continues its reign as a benchmark, earning accolades for its well-balanced chassis, potent engine options—including the increasingly popular plug-in hybrid (PHEV) variants—and an interior that masterfully blends functionality with upscale materials. For 2025, we’re seeing refinements to its iDrive infotainment system, making it more intuitive than ever, alongside enhanced driver-assistance features. The X4, its coupe-SUV sibling, leans further into sporty aesthetics and a more engaging driving posture, sacrificing a touch of utility for a bolder statement. These models epitomize BMW’s commitment to driving pleasure, even in a family-friendly package.
Mercedes-Benz counters with the GLC, a perennial favorite renowned for its plush cabin, serene ride quality, and sophisticated design. Its MBUX infotainment system, with its impressive voice recognition and customizable displays, often feels a step ahead in terms of user experience. The GLB, with its optional third row, offers unique versatility in this class, appealing to buyers who need occasional extra seating without stepping up to a midsize SUV. For 2025, Mercedes has further refined the GLC’s powertrains, emphasizing efficiency and smooth power delivery. While it may not offer the same raw athletic edge as the X3, the GLC often excels in its ability to cocoon occupants in comfort and advanced technology.
Verdict: BMW slightly edges out Mercedes-Benz in this segment for its more engaging driving dynamics and broader range of high-performance options that truly embody the “ultimate driving machine” ethos, making it a compelling choice for enthusiasts seeking a compact luxury SUV.
Luxury Electric Cars: The Silent Revolution
The electrification of luxury is no longer a future concept; it’s a 2025 reality, with both German marques pouring significant investment into their EV lineups. This segment is where the future of premium automotive brands is truly being forged.
BMW’s electric offerings are becoming increasingly formidable. The i4, a sleek electric Gran Coupe, directly challenges Tesla and other new entrants with its impressive performance, surprising agility, and a familiar BMW driving feel. It’s an excellent showcase of how to electrify an existing successful platform without losing its core identity. At the pinnacle sits the i7, BMW’s electric flagship sedan. Sharing its platform with the latest 7 Series, the i7 offers a commanding presence, breathtaking acceleration, and a rear passenger experience rivaling private jets, complete with a massive Theatre Screen. For 2025, BMW has focused on optimizing charging infrastructure and range consistency, addressing key consumer concerns in the electric luxury sedan comparison.
Mercedes-Benz, with its dedicated EQ sub-brand, presents a lineup that emphasizes futuristic design and serene, silent luxury. The EQE Sedan offers an electric counterpart to the E-Class, delivering a remarkably smooth ride and an exquisitely appointed, tech-laden cabin. The EQS Sedan, Mercedes’ electric flagship, is a rolling testament to advanced automotive technology 2025. Its Hyperscreen infotainment system is a visual marvel, and its exceptional range and swift charging capabilities make it a strong contender for the best electric luxury car 2025. Mercedes’ strategy often prioritizes a more isolated, refined electric experience, pushing the boundaries of in-cabin digital integration.
Verdict: BMW takes the lead here, primarily due to the versatility and driving pleasure offered by the i4, combined with the i7’s more conventional yet undeniably luxurious and high-performance approach to the flagship EV segment.

Luxury Large Cars: Flagship Supremacy
When it comes to the pinnacle of automotive luxury, the flagship sedan segment is where brands showcase their ultimate engineering prowess and design philosophies. This is a head-to-head battle for supreme comfort and prestige.
Mercedes-Benz has long dominated this space with the legendary S-Class. In 2025, the S-Class remains the gold standard for luxury large cars. It’s not merely transportation; it’s an experience, with its whisper-quiet cabin, active suspension systems that smooth out any road imperfection, and a truly presidential rear-seat environment. The latest MBUX innovations and advanced semi-autonomous driving features underscore its position as a technological tour de force. The S-Class effortlessly combines refined power with unmatched comfort, setting the benchmark for the luxury car buying guide.
BMW’s 7 Series offers a distinctly different, yet equally compelling, take on the flagship luxury sedan 2025. While still immensely comfortable, the 7 Series retains a stronger connection to the road, offering a more driver-centric experience than its Mercedes counterpart. Its bold, polarizing design language sets it apart, and its interior, while supremely luxurious, integrates technology in a way that feels progressive and engaging. The iDrive system, refined over many iterations, offers a powerful, customizable interface. The choice often boils down to whether you prioritize being driven in ultimate comfort or prefer a more hands-on, yet equally luxurious, driving experience.
Verdict: Mercedes-Benz retains its crown here. The S-Class continues to define what a luxury flagship should be, with its unparalleled comfort, serene cabin, and forward-thinking technology.

Beyond the Segments: A Deeper Dive into Brand Philosophy
Beyond individual model comparisons, the overall brand philosophies around safety, performance, reliability, and interior design play a critical role in the BMW vs. Mercedes ultimate guide.
Safety: Both BMW and Mercedes-Benz are at the forefront of automotive safety. In 2025, their vehicles are packed with the latest adv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S), including highly sophisticated semi-autonomous driving capabilities, predictive collision avoidance, and advanced lane-keeping technologies. While crash test ratings are generally excellent across both lineups, BMW often provides a slightly more comprehensive suite of active safety features as standard across more models, earning it a fractional edge. Both brands are also leading the charge in integrating AI into safety protocols, predicting potential hazards with unprecedented accuracy.
Performance: This has traditionally been BMW’s forte, and in 2025, it remains a core strength. From the engaging dynamics of a 3 Series to the exhilarating power of an M model or the surprisingly potent acceleration of its i-series EVs, BMW consistently delivers a driver-centric experience. Mercedes-Benz, while offering powerful AMG variants and exceptionally smooth powertrains in its non-AMG models, generally prioritizes refined comfort and effortless power delivery over raw, unadulterated sportiness. The electrification push, however, has seen both brands embrace instantaneous torque, blurring the lines of traditional performance metrics. BMW’s direct steering and balanced chassis often provide a more communicative driving experience.
Reliability & Ownership: In 2025, both brands continue to enhance their manufacturing quality and build robust vehicles. While luxury cars, by nature of their complexity, can incur higher maintenance costs, both BMW and Mercedes-Benz offer solid warranties (typically 4-year/50,000-mile powertrain). Predicted reliability scores from independent organizations like J.D. Power vary by model, but generally, BMW models tend to report slightly more consistently higher scores across a broader range of their lineup. Electric vehicle battery warranties are also competitive, with Mercedes-Benz sometimes offering slightly longer coverage (e.g., 10-year/155,000-mile for some EV batteries vs. BMW’s 8-year/100,000-mile).
Interior & Technology: This is where Mercedes-Benz truly shines and often sets the industry standard for premium interior design. The fit, finish, material quality, and sheer aesthetic appeal of a Mercedes cabin—especially in models like the S-Class, E-Class, or GLE—are frequently unparalleled. Their MBUX infotainment system, particularly with the Hyperscreen, offers an immersive, intuitive, and visually stunning digital experience. BMW, while offering excellent build quality and increasingly sophisticated cabins (especially in the i7 and X1/X3), tends to adopt a more functional elegance. Its iDrive system is incredibly powerful and customizable but can sometimes feel less immediately intuitive than MBUX for first-time users. Mercedes often creates a more luxurious and cocooning environment, a key differentiator in the luxury car buying guide.
